2. Wear a stable bra

In addition to preventing breast sagging, the more important function of a bra is to prevent further compression of the already compressed breast nerves and eliminate discomfort. Careful sisters will find that those jogging athletes wear stable bras for this health reason.

3. Try hot compress

Hot compress is a traditional Chinese medical treatment that can relieve breast pain by using a hot pack, hot water bottle, or hot bath. If you use alternating cold and hot compresses, the effect of eliminating breast discomfort will be better.
